簡介

美國在1995年時超越日本成為最大的半導體生產國家。然而美國的主導權在全球的半導體產業中依然備受威脅。在這樣的情形下,美國產業以及政府被迫做出對應。預測在2010年時美國的半導體市場,將會達到554億美金的市場價值,從2005年以來將會上升29%。

Abstract

The first five years of the 1990s were a period of tremendous growth for the semiconductor materials industry. The increase in production of computers swelled the need for semiconductors, as did the significant increase in semiconductor orders from the communications industry, various consumer products manufacturers, and the automotive industry. The US re-emerged over Japan as the largest producer of semiconductors in 1995.

The United States faces a growing threat to its leadership of the world semiconductor industry. A combination of market forces and foreign industrial policies is creating powerful incentives to shift new chip production offshore. If this trend continues, the U.S. lead in chip manufacturing, equipment, and design may well erode, with important and unpleasant consequences for U.S. productivity growth and, ultimately, the country' s economic and military security. To address this challenge, U.S. industry and the government need to cooperate to determine their response.

The US represents a leading market for semiconductors, primarily due to its vast electronic-based sectors. In 2010, the US semiconductors market is forecast to have a value of $55.4 billion, an increase of 29% since 2005. Integrated circuits are the leading sector in the semiconductors market generating 89.1% of the market' s value.
